Choosing Your Ideal Double Room in Arusha: Location, Location, Location
Arusha is a sprawling city, and where you choose to stay can significantly impact your convenience and overall experience, especially when you’re looking for double room accommodation in Arusha for couples. The location influences ease of access to transportation, restaurants, shops, and tour operator offices. Understanding the different areas will help you make an informed decision for your 2026-2027 trip.
Staying Near the City Center
Arusha’s city center is a hub of activity. Staying here offers unparalleled access to amenities and services.
Pros:
- Convenience: Easy access to banks, ATMs, supermarkets, pharmacies, local markets, and a wide variety of restaurants and cafes.
- Tour Operator Proximity: Many safari and Kilimanjaro tour operators have offices in or near the city center, making pre-trip briefings and last-minute arrangements straightforward.
- Transportation Hub: Good access to dala-dalas (local minibuses) and taxi services for exploring the city or reaching further destinations.
- Vibrant Atmosphere: If you enjoy being in the heart of the action, the city center offers a lively environment.
Cons:
- Noise and Traffic: Can be busier and noisier than areas further out.
- Less Scenic: Generally less green and more urban than outskirts or specialized lodges.
Who it suits: Couples who prioritize convenience, easy access to services, and being close to tour operator arrangements. It’s also good for those who want to explore Arusha town itself.
Staying Near Usa River / Kiloleni Area
The Usa River and Kiloleni areas are located a bit outside the immediate city center, often towards the airport or on the road to Moshi. These areas offer a slightly more tranquil setting while still being relatively accessible.
Pros:
- Quieter Environment: Generally more peaceful than the bustling city center, offering a more relaxed atmosphere.
- Proximity to JRO Airport: Often closer to Kilimanjaro International Airport (JRO), making arrival and departure transfers smoother.
- Green Surroundings: Properties in these areas often feature more space, gardens, and a more natural setting.
- Good for Pre-Safari Relaxation: Ideal for couples wanting to decompress before or after a safari without being too far from Arusha’s services.
Cons:
- Less Walkable: You’ll likely need taxis or private transport to get to shops, restaurants, or tour offices in the city center.
- Fewer On-site Amenities: Some smaller establishments might have limited dining options.
Who it suits: Couples looking for a quieter stay, easier airport access, or a more lodge-like feel without being too far from Arusha’s conveniences.
Staying on the Outskirts / Rural Settings
For those seeking an escape, properties located further out, perhaps on the slopes of Mount Meru or in surrounding rural areas, offer a truly serene experience.
Pros:
- Tranquility and Nature: Beautiful natural surroundings, often with stunning views, abundant birdlife, and a peaceful ambiance.
- Unique Experiences: Proximity to coffee plantations, local villages, or natural attractions.
- Romantic Atmosphere: Ideal for couples seeking privacy and a romantic setting away from the urban buzz.
Cons:
- Isolation: Requires reliable transport for any excursions into Arusha town or to tour operator offices.
- Limited Access to Services: You’ll be reliant on the accommodation’s own facilities or pre-arranged transport for dining and shopping.
Who it suits: Couples prioritizing peace, nature, and a romantic getaway, who don’t mind being a drive away from the city center and are prepared with transport arrangements.

When to Book
Arusha is a popular destination year-round, but certain periods see higher demand. For 2026-2027, consider these booking windows:
- Peak Seasons (June-October, December-February): These are generally the driest and most pleasant months for safaris and trekking. Book at least 3-6 months in advance, especially for well-regarded hotels or during holidays.
- Shoulder Seasons (March-May, November): While May can be rainy, these periods can offer fewer crowds and potentially better rates. Booking 2-4 months ahead is still advisable.
- Low Season (April-May): The ‘green season’ can be beautiful but wetter. Accommodation might be more readily available, but booking 1-3 months in advance is still prudent for popular spots.
Tip: If your travel dates are flexible, exploring options during shoulder or low seasons might yield great deals on double room accommodation in Arusha.

What to Confirm Before Booking
- Inclusions: Does the rate include breakfast? Are taxes included?
- Cancellation Policy: Understand the terms for changes or cancellations, especially important for international travel planning.
- Check-in/Check-out Times: Ensure they align with your travel schedule.
- Room Specifics: If you have preferences (e.g., a quiet room, a room with a view), confirm these are noted or guaranteed. For couples, a room away from high-traffic areas might be preferred.
- Airport Transfers: If offered, confirm the cost, meeting point, and if it needs to be pre-booked.
